Striking contours and horizontal lines make the W166<br />

series more masculine and athletic. Other contributing factors<br />

include the modified proportions: the vehicle is now<br />

15 mm wider than the W164, while the roof height has<br />

been lowered by 19 mm.<br />

Key elements of the M-<strong>Class</strong> exterior design include:<br />

• Elongated lines of the side view emphasise the on-road<br />

character<br />

• Design cast from a single mould with continuous tail<br />

lights and flowing transition from the rear side windows<br />

to the rear window<br />

• Characteristic C-pillar in hallmark M-<strong>Class</strong> style<br />

• Powerful, self-confident radiator grille with large centrally<br />

positioned star<br />

• Large chrome-style underguard typical of an SUV in<br />

the front and rear bumper

Chrome-plated roof rails are the basic carriers for transporting<br />

objects on the vehicle roof. With the appropriate accessories,<br />

bicycles or roof boxes can be securely fastened.<br />

Sliding sunroof<br />

The electrically operated sliding glass sunroof features<br />

convenience functions such as “automatic opening” and<br />

“automatic closing”. A headliner, which can be moved from<br />

inside, provides protection against sunlight.<br />

Panoramic sliding sunroof<br />

The panoramic sliding sunroof consists of a fixed panoramic<br />

glass roof and an electrically operated glass sunroof which<br />

slides over the exterior of the roof. The transparent surface<br />

area is very large and lets in plenty of light.<br />

Customer benefit<br />

The panoramic sliding sunroof offers the following customer<br />

benefits:<br />

• Creates a transparent surface area which is double the<br />

size of that available with conventional sliding glass<br />

sunroofs<br />

• Gives the interior a particularly light and welcoming feel<br />

• Sunblinds provide effective protection against direct<br />

sunlight<br />

• Size of opening is around 1/3 larger than conventional<br />

sliding sunroofs<br />

• Easy operation thanks to multifunction switch in the<br />

overhead control panel

Load compartment <strong>–</strong> spacious and flexible<br />

The M-<strong>Class</strong> provides the largest load compartment in the segment. The rear seats are 1/3:2/3 split-folding seats.<br />

Intelligent equipment such as the EASY-PACK load-securing kit or the lockable laptop compartment mean that the load<br />

compartment can be used flexibly.<br />

The M-<strong>Class</strong> sets the benchmark with the key load compartment dimensions:<br />

• Largest load compartment capacity behind 1st row of seats at 2010 l and largest load compartment capacity behind<br />

2nd row of seats at 690 l<br />

• Largest load compartment length behind 1st row of seats measuring 1833 mm and largest load compartment length<br />

behind 2nd row of seats measuring 1046 mm<br />

• Largest through-loading height at 839 mm<br />

The load compartment volume includes a stowage space of 90 litres under the load compartment floor.<br />

The noticeable reduction in fuel consumption and emissions<br />

in the M-<strong>Class</strong> illustrates that environmental compatibility<br />

and SUV motoring are reconcilable. But the careful<br />

use of resources is not limited solely to driving: the international<br />

environmental certificate “Design for Environment”<br />

(ISO/TR 14062) attests to the high environmental compatibility<br />

of the M-<strong>Class</strong>, from production and usage to end-oflife<br />

disposal.<br />

BlueEFFICIENCY >56-431245<br />

Measures relating to the vehicle, engine and drive system<br />

have reduced fuel consumption in the M-<strong>Class</strong> by up to<br />

28% compared with the outgoing model series.<br />

The following measures permit reduced fuel consumption<br />

and low emissions:<br />

• Innovative engines with direct injection and diesel engines<br />

featuring BlueTEC technology<br />

• ECO start/stop function as standard<br />

• Consumption-optimised 7G-TRONIC PLUS automatic<br />

transmission<br />

• Demand-responsive components<br />

• Improved aerodynamics

Safe driving<br />

• Tyre pressure loss warning system alerts the driver<br />

early on to a loss of pressure detected in a tyre.<br />

• Light package (optional extra, from 04/12) with<br />

Intelligent Light System and Adaptive Highbeam Assist<br />

automatically adjusts the adaptive bi-xenon headlamps<br />

to the driving situation, thus improving the driver’s<br />

vision.<br />

In case of danger<br />

• PRE-SAFE ® triggers anticipatory occupant protection<br />

measures if the system detects a risk of accident. For<br />

example, the front seat belts are tensioned by electromotive<br />

means. The side windows and the sliding sunroof<br />

can also be closed if required and the position of the<br />

front passenger seat can be adjusted.<br />

• BAS PLUS (included in the optional Driving Assistance<br />

package Plus) assists the driver where necessary by<br />

applying additional brake force during braking.<br />

• PRE-SAFE ® Brake (included with optional Driving<br />

Assistance package Plus) can apply the brakes if the<br />

risk of a collision has been detected, and the driver<br />

fails to respond to the visual and acoustic warnings.<br />

In an accident<br />

• Two-stage driver and passenger airbags<br />

• Thorax/pelvis airbags, a completely new design for improved<br />

driver and front passenger protection in the<br />

event of a side impact<br />

• Pyrotechnic belt tensioners and belt force limiters for<br />

the front seats and for the rear outside seats<br />

• Kneebag can protect the driver in the knee contact area<br />

with the dashboard<br />

• Active bonnet helps reduce risk of injury to pedestrians<br />

in collisions<br />

After an accident<br />

Depending on the type of accident and the severity of the<br />

impact, various means can be activated. These include:<br />

• Automatic unlocking of the doors<br />

• Engine and fuel pump are shut off automatically<br />

• Side windows lowered by 50 mm<br />

• Activation of hazard warning lights<br />

• Activation of interior lighting<br />

• Crash interlock for auxiliary heater<br />

A handle below the light switch allows simple, reliable operation<br />

of the electric parking brake.<br />

Customer benefits<br />

The electric parking brake offers the following customer<br />

benefits:<br />

• Omission of pedal means more space in footwell<br />

• Light-action handle operation for extra convenience<br />

• Assist functions make driverʼs job easier<br />

Design<br />

The electric parking brake comprises the following<br />

elements:<br />

• Control buttons<br />

• Wiring<br />

• Duo-servo parking brake integrated into the rear-wheel<br />

brakes<br />

Operation<br />

The brake can be released by letting out the control button<br />

when the ignition is turned on.<br />

The brake is automatically released when:<br />

• The engine is running<br />

• The selector lever is in position D or R<br />

• The bonnet and boot are closed<br />

• The driver is belted in<br />

• The accelerator pedal is depressed<br />

The ON&OFFROAD package gives the driver more control<br />

over the handling characteristics of the vehicle <strong>–</strong> both on<br />

and off the road. The driver can choose between various<br />

pre-defined drive programs via a switch. These drive programs<br />

are designed to adapt the vehicle configuration as<br />

best as possible to the driving situation and road quality.<br />

Customer benefits<br />

The ON&OFFROAD package offers the following customer<br />

benefits:<br />

• Pre-defined drive programs for various road qualities<br />

• Optimised and interconnected vehicle configuration for<br />

the selected program<br />

• Drive program and effects displayed in COMAND display<br />

• Gradient and angle of inclination indicated in COMAND<br />

display<br />

Construction<br />

The ON&OFFROAD package includes the following<br />

components:<br />

• Drive program switch<br />

• Manual mode for automatic transmission<br />

• 100% differential locks on middle differential<br />

• Front and rear axle with adapted 4ETS<br />

• Off-road ratio<br />

• Underbody protection beneath engine<br />

• Reinforced underfloor panelling<br />

• Special off-road algorithm for ABS, ETS, EPS ® and<br />

air suspension<br />

The ACTIVE CURVE SYSTEM reduces the vehicleʼs roll<br />

angle when cornering through its active suspension stabilisers.<br />

This enhances ride comfort for the vehicle occupants<br />

and boosts driving dynamics both at medium speed (winding<br />

rural roads) and also at high speed (motorways).<br />

Costumer benefit<br />

The ACTIVE CURVE SYSTEM offers the following customer<br />

benefits:<br />

• Reduced roll angle when cornering<br />

• Speed-dependent driving dynamics (more agility and<br />

driving pleasure at medium speed, greater directional<br />

stability at high speed)<br />

• Greater ride comfort for vehicle occupants<br />

Design<br />

The ACTIVE CURVE SYSTEM comprises the following<br />

elements:<br />

• Active suspension stabilisers on each axle<br />

• Hydraulic pump with oil reservoir<br />

• Valve blocks front/rear<br />

• Electronic control unit<br />

• Pressure sensors and lateral acceleration sensor<br />

Thanks to new and enhanced technology as well as ultimate flexibility, the new<br />

M-<strong>Class</strong> occupies the leading position in its segment. Here, the worldʼs most aerodynamically<br />

efficient standard SUV has faced competition from the “dynamic”<br />

BMW X5 (since 2007), among others. The lack of a complete air suspension system,<br />

however, would suggest that the X5 is not capable of achieving maximum<br />

performance in terms of either ride comfort or off-road handling.<br />

The Touareg and Cayenne share the same heritage (since 2010) <strong>–</strong> but while the<br />

VW has taken the more comfortable, practical route, the Porsche occupies a significantly<br />

sportier position. Their operating systems, with touchscreen monitors,<br />

have also been laid out differently. In the case of the Cayenne, the centre console<br />

is inundated with buttons, whereas the layout in the Touareg is much less cluttered.<br />

An identical offering from both, on the other hand, is the so-called parallel<br />

hybrid version with V6 TFSI petrol engine (245 kW/333 hp) and electric motor<br />

(34 kW/47 hp). Purely electric operation, however <strong>–</strong> up to a maximum of two kilometres,<br />

at up to 50 km/h <strong>–</strong> remains for the most part a theoretical concept, and<br />

there is certainly no comparison with diesel consumption values. Furthermore,<br />

the hybrid is almost exclusively offered in a full equipment version.<br />

This is a problem common to all competitors with the expensive Porsche at the<br />

forefront: compared with the M-<strong>Class</strong>, generally significantly inferior standard<br />

equipment. Even a Bluetooth connection for mobile phones attracts an additional<br />

charge. But overall, the M-<strong>Class</strong> impresses as the best all-rounder <strong>–</strong> thanks to its<br />

leading credentials, primarily in terms of comfort and fuel consumption, innovative<br />

safety equipment and the largest load compartment in the segment.<br />
